In total, Kinky Boots won three awards, Best New Broadway Musical, Outstanding New Score and Actor in a Musical (Billy Porter).
The revival of Pippin was the big winner for the night, taking home seven awards. We may not be big fans of organized awards shows but when a couple of our own get a nod its time to pause and high five our people. Consider that done
